High-tech and export-oriented enterprises with high added value make a significant contribution to the country’s modernization, President Rumen Radev said at the inaugural ceremony of a new plant for automotive components in Vratsa.
Teklas-Bulgaria has opened its sixth plant in Bulgaria. The new investment amounts to EUR 10 million. So far the company has created 300 new jobs. It is expected to create more jobs in the coming years.
